Civivi pry tool (comes with a luggage tag which is not shown in the photos):






Though much thinner than the EverRatchet, it probably works better as a prybar. With tools this size, you probably would not try to exert enough force to bend the tool. But it is desirable for it to be thin enough to slide under items that you can't get a finger tip under. The EverRatchet was too thick to slide under the square washer seen in pic #3.

I have a Gerber Mullet as well, great pics :like: I do believe I prefer the Shard as well :tu: :like:

Did you know the Shard started out as only a promotional item to advertise for the Gerber Artifact  :salute:

Grant received one at SHOT Show or some show :think: and showed it here on MTO and after a while there was such a positive want for them that Gerber decided to put them into regular production and I believe they have probably outsold the Artifact :ahhh

Here are the ones closest at hand.  I enjoyed my Shard till I left it mistakenly at a clients home.  I got the LM by The Numbers and the #4 became by go to.  I then went for a while without a OPT on my keychain till got another Shard.  I don't know why but I didn't reconnect with it so I took it off my keychain.

I like and prefer my Mullet more that the Shard.  Larger means more leverage over the really small tools.  I used it the other day to dislodge a nail and open a paint can as well as scrape.   

I bought a trio of CnC ( cheap and Cheerful ) pry tools and one is on my work tool belt.  Its decent but I did bend one.  I cannot recall where the other is.  Sorry no pic.   

My PW2 was bought a while ago ( I got 2 ).  It really is a great tool.  I also have one on my work tool belt in my surge sheath.
